首页 > 编程语言
[Python]网络爬虫(三):异常的处理和HTTP状态码的分类
转自:http://blog.csdn.net/pleasecallmewhy/article/details/8923725 先来说一说HTTP的异常处理问题。 当urlopen不能够处理一个response时,产生urlError。 不过通常的Python APIs异常如ValueError,T...
分类:编程语言   时间:2014-01-25 19:42:07    收藏:0  评论:0  赞:0  阅读:514
[Python]网络爬虫(二):利用urllib2通过指定的URL抓取网页内容
转自:http://blog.csdn.net/pleasecallmewhy/article/details/8923067 所谓网页抓取,就是把URL地址中指定的网络资源从网络流中读取出来,保存到本地。 类似于使用程序模拟IE浏览器的功能,把URL作为HTTP请求的内容发送到服务器端, 然后读取...
分类:编程语言   时间:2014-01-25 19:27:07    收藏:0  评论:0  赞:0  阅读:462
python与java split的不同
python:text = "GET /report.gif?code=_qualityPluginLoaded&app=click&cid=fengyun_0000000001_1342934731354&host=soft.yuyu.com&rd=0.580433264374733 HTTP/1...
分类:编程语言   时间:2014-01-25 18:52:07    收藏:0  评论:0  赞:0  阅读:395
解释型程序python\java与编译型程序C在IO以及运行上的效率差异
最近特别喜欢使用python编写一些短小而且实用的程序,并且由于专业上的需求(python在科学程序上的应用非常的广泛,我们实验室的密码库基本上都是含有C封装的python模块),所以我想将python应用到更广泛的范围。但是据说python在解释上的效率相当的不理想,由此我想到了三个问题:1.如果...
分类:编程语言   时间:2014-01-25 18:51:17    收藏:0  评论:0  赞:0  阅读:387
关于python打包成exe的一点经验之谈
我经常用python写些脚本什么的,有时候脚本写完以后,每次运行都得在IDE打开在运行,很麻烦,所以经常将python编译成exe.SO...有了一点经验,在这和大家分享一下。 python 打包成exe 主要有两种,一种是py2exe,另一种便是pyInstaller,之前我是用py2exe的,但...
分类:编程语言   时间:2014-01-25 18:42:57    收藏:0  评论:0  赞:0  阅读:683
[Python]项目打包:5步将py文件打包成exe文件 简介
1.下载pyinstaller并解压(可以去官网下载最新版): http://nchc.dl.sourceforge.net/project/pyinstaller/2.0/pyinstaller-2.0.zip 2.下载pywin32并安装(注意版本,我的是python2.7): http://d...
分类:编程语言   时间:2014-01-25 18:23:47    收藏:0  评论:0  赞:0  阅读:437
使用C语言实现“泛型”链表
看到这个标题,你可能非常惊讶,C语言也能实现泛型链表?我们知道链表是我们非常常用的数据结构,但是在C中却没有像C++中的STL那样有一个list的模板类,那么我们是否可以用C语言实现一个像STL中的list那样的泛型链表呢?答案是肯定的。下面就以本人的一个用C语言设计的链表为例子,来分析说明一下本人的设计和实现要点,希望能给你一点有用的帮助。 一、所用的链表类型的选择 我们知道,链表也...
分类:编程语言   时间:2014-01-25 17:20:27    收藏:0  评论:0  赞:0  阅读:624
zz:c语言中static用法总结
摘要: C语言程序可以看成由一系列外部对象构成,这些外部对象可能是变量或函数。而内部变量是指定义在函数内部的函数参数及变量。外部变量定义在函数之外,因此可以在许多函数中使用。由于C语言不允许在一个函数中定义其它 ...一、c程序存储空间布局C程序一直由下列部分组成: 正文段——CPU执行的机器指令部...
分类:编程语言   时间:2014-01-25 17:05:27    收藏:0  评论:0  赞:0  阅读:379
Python快速入门(1)简介、函数、字符串
01 Python在Linux中的常用命令: 进入: python #可以安装ipython,这样会自带代码提示功能 退出: exit() 进入Python命令行 清屏命令: ctrl + L 查看帮助 help()   # ex. help(list) Python提供内置函数实现进制转换: bin() hex() 02 Python文件类型:...
分类:编程语言   时间:2014-01-25 16:43:47    收藏:0  评论:0  赞:0  阅读:503
Python快速入门(2)练习题
# C. fix_start # Given a string s, return a string # where all occurences of its first char have # been changed to '*', except do not change # the first char itself. # e.g. 'babble' yields 'ba**l...
分类:编程语言   时间:2014-01-25 16:18:47    收藏:0  评论:0  赞:0  阅读:524
Python快速入门(3)列表、练习题
06 序列:(三种类型) 字符串   不可以修改 列表list []  可以修改   ex.[1,2.3] 元组tuple ()  不可以修改  ex. uinfo = ('well,'male',20,'njupt') ----特点: 1.可以进行索引,索引为负数,则从右边开始计数 2.可以使用切片操作符 [m:n] ----基本序列操作: 1. len() 2....
分类:编程语言   时间:2014-01-25 16:17:57    收藏:0  评论:0  赞:0  阅读:490
Python快速入门(4)排序、字典、文件
08  Python Sorting: 1.最简单的排序方式: #sorted(list) function: which takes a list and returns a new list with those elements in sorted order a = [5, 1, 4, 3] print sorted(a) ## [1, 3, 4, 5] pri...
分类:编程语言   时间:2014-01-25 16:08:47    收藏:0  评论:0  赞:0  阅读:480
c/c++调用lua函数
lua环境由所有可操作的数据构成,编译好的函数,变量以及其他运行时内存。而所有的这些数据都将保存一个叫做lua_State的结构中。一个lua程序至少有个个lua_State,被称作lua环境,是用来发送和接收数据的地方,支撑着与其他语言的交互,具体来说就是利用lua栈(lua_Stack)来实现。 在c/c++中调用函数,具体过程可以分为几步:                ...
分类:编程语言   时间:2014-01-25 16:37:07    收藏:0  评论:0  赞:0  阅读:452
【转】C++对象内存分配问题
原文:http://blog.csdn.net/c504665913/article/details/7797859如果一个人自称为程序高手,却对内存一无所知,那么我可以告诉你,他一定在吹牛。用C或C++写程序,需要更多地关注内存,这不仅仅是因为内存的分配是否合理直接影响着程序的效率和性能,更为主要...
分类:编程语言   时间:2014-01-25 14:36:17    收藏:0  评论:0  赞:0  阅读:461
Python::OS 模块 -- 文件和目录操作
os模块的简介参看 Python::OS 模块 -- 简介 os模块中包含了一系列文件操作的函数,这里介绍的是一些在Linux平台上应用的文件操作函数。由于Linux是C写的,低层的libc库和系统调用的接口都是C API,而Python的os模块中包括了对这写接口的Python实现,通过Pytho...
分类:编程语言   时间:2014-01-25 13:37:06    收藏:0  评论:0  赞:0  阅读:454
c语言-结构体
1.结构体是用来定义自己的类型,这个类型可以很复杂,也可以很简单。我们一般都是定义自己想要,方便自己编程的结构体。2.定义结构体的一般格式为:struct 结构名{ 成员列表.(这里有若干个成员组成,每个成员都是这个结构的一个组成部分,对每个成员也必须作类型的声明。)}example:struct ...
分类:编程语言   时间:2014-01-25 09:07:57    收藏:0  评论:0  赞:0  阅读:476
从C,C++,JAVA和C#看String库的发展(一)----C语言和C++篇
转自: http://www.cnblogs.com/wenjiang/p/3266305.html 基本上所有主流的编程语言都有String的标准库,因为字符串操作是我们每个程序员几乎每天都要遇到的。想想我们至今的代码,到底生成和使用了多少String!标题上所罗列的语言,可以看成是一脉相承的,它...
分类:编程语言   时间:2014-01-25 09:05:27    收藏:0  评论:0  赞:0  阅读:569
C++类库介绍
如果你有一定的C基础可能学起来比较容易些,但是学习C++的过程中又要尽量避免去使用一些C中的思想;平时还要多看一些高手写的代码,遇到问题多多思考,怎样才能把问题抽象化,以使自己头脑中有类的概念;最后别忘了经常上机自己调调程序,这是谁也代替不了的。 C++类库介绍 再次体现了C++保持核心语言的效率同...
分类:编程语言   时间:2014-01-25 08:36:04    收藏:0  评论:0  赞:0  阅读:490
C++ 对象的内存布局
陈皓http://blog.csdn.net/haoel点击这里查看下篇>>>前言07年12月,我写了一篇《C++虚函数表解析》的文章,引起了大家的兴趣。有很多朋友对我的文章留了言,有鼓励我的,有批评我的,还有很多问问题的。我在这里一并对大家的留言表示感谢。这也是我为什么再写一篇续言的原因。因为,在...
分类:编程语言   时间:2014-01-25 08:30:14    收藏:0  评论:0  赞:0  阅读:477
webdriver(python) 学习笔记三
自动化 webdriver
分类:编程语言   时间:2014-01-25 08:15:14    收藏:0  评论:0  赞:0  阅读:931
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!